Celebrating her successes and coping with life's challenges

A Life Well Lived Through Words is an account of a woman's lifelong struggle with love, relationships, geopolitical issues, lawyering, and disease. Sharon Greenspan has always looked to poetry and writing to find her peace. She writes about her life as an immigration attorney, both in private practice and for the U.S. Immigration and Naturalization Service, her relationship with her daughter Samantha, her challenging loves, and her battle with chronic fatigue syndrome. She weaves a story of a life well lived through words.

Greenspans poems are poignant at times, at other times whimsical, almost fey. She has organized her work well and included both intimate thoughts about her relationships, grander themes such as 9-11, and the foundation of the state of Israel. Taken together, they tell her stories with verve and charm.

-The US Review of Books
